Who Is Spirit AeroSystems (Europe) Limited?
Spirit AeroSystems (Europe) Limited is a leading manufacturer in the global aerospace sector, renowned for its advanced design and production of aerostructures for both commercial and defense aircraft.
Established as a private limited company on 29 December 2005, Spirit Europe forms a critical part of the broader Spirit AeroSystems group, one of the largest aerostructure manufacturers in the world, headquartered in Wichita, Kansas, USA.
With a strong operational footprint in the United Kingdom through facilities in Belfast, Northern Ireland, and Prestwick, Scotland, Spirit AeroSystems (Europe) Limited is a strategic supplier to major aircraft programmes, particularly those operated by Airbus.
The company specialises in the production of fuselage sections, wing components, pylons, nacelles, and integrated systems, combining decades of heritage with cutting-edge technology.
The company’s operations are grounded in a legacy of innovation, drawing on the pioneering histories of aviation icons such as Short Brothers, Boeing, BAE Systems, and Bombardier.
Today, Spirit Europe is one of the UK’s foremost contributors to the aerospace supply chain, delivering high-precision, mission-critical components to OEMs across the globe.

What Is the Company’s Capital Structure and Financial Status?
Spirit AeroSystems (Europe) Limited is a Private Limited Company, actively operating since 29 December 2005. Initially registered as Blockmist Limited, the company adopted its current name shortly thereafter to reflect its integration into the Spirit AeroSystems global brand.

Engineering and Technology Excellence
Spirit’s UK facilities are especially notable for their advanced wing fabrication capabilities, used in the Airbus A320, A330, and A350 programs. The company invests significantly in R&D and employs a large team of engineers, composite specialists, and manufacturing experts.
Global Collaboration
With operations in the US, UK, France, Malaysia, and Morocco, Spirit AeroSystems operates a globally integrated supply chain, aligning manufacturing output with the needs of aerospace OEMs like Boeing and Airbus.
